» 网友学堂 » PHP教程 » 24小时只弹一次的弹窗代码 maxthon下照弹
24小时只弹一次的弹窗代码 maxthon下照弹
作者:问天 发表时间:2007-12-8 20:21 阅读:1014次 在百度搜索相关内容

根据cookie设置弹窗,我们这里使用的是php的cookie.
直接插入php程序内的代码如下
以下是代码:

<?
ob_start();
$time=$HTTP_COOKIE_VARS["time"];
if(!$time or (($time+86400)<time())){
echo '<script type="text/javascript">
setTimeout("focus();window.open (\'http://www.vkdown.com\',)",5000);
</script>';
setcookie("time",time());
}
?>

说明:本代码setTimeout中 修改部分为网址和延迟时间,这里是5秒(5000毫秒); 本代码直接插入到php的程序中即可.

如果网站不支持php,可以找一个支持php的连接来调用.形式如下
以下是代码:

<?
ob_start();
$time=$HTTP_COOKIE_VARS["time"];
if(!$time or (($time+86400)<time())){
echo '
setTimeout("focus();window.open (\'http://www.vkdown.com\',)",5000);
';
setcookie("time",time());
}
?>

以上文件保存成****.php,并传到支持php的网站目录下面.如 http://www.xxx.com/js/目录下.
在自己的网站上引用时,直接调用即可,调用代码如下:
以下是代码:
<script type="text/javascript" src="http://www.xxx.com/js/****.php"></script>